Epic Games has announced that The Evil Within and Eternal Threads are free to claim from the Epic Games Store until October 26. The first title—which appears to be the first AAA freebie that Epic has offered in a while—is a survival horror game from Tango Gameworks and Resident Evil creator Shinji Mikami that requires some tweaks for better enjoyment (instructions on how to remove the 60 FPS frame cap here), while Eternal Threads is a puzzle game with themes of "time manipulation, choice, and consequence" from the developers at Cosmonaut Studios. Next week's Epic Games Store freebies are Tandem: A Tale of Shadows and The Evil Within 2, just in time for Halloween.
